Pursue your ambitions in creative arts and design with the BA (Hons) Film (with Foundation Year) at Bournemouth University. Based in Poole, England, this programme combines theoretical knowledge with practical application, with a 4-year full-time structure. Film is a language all of its own – images, sounds and stories driven by history, genre, and artistry. Develop filmmaking skills from concept to completion, production to critical comprehension, with fellow film lovers passionate about shaping the future. What’s included in your tuition fee? Your tuition fee covers expenses associated with your course including tuition materials, access to facilities, mandatory field trips and the following: Materials for laboratory and mandatory field-based teaching activity Support for finding placements (UK or abroad) and fieldwork, and non-financial support whilst on placement if this is part of your course of study A range of student services – advisors, help desks, counsellors, placement support and careers
